Ella Purnell, an actress whose credits include KICK-ASS 2, MISS PEREGRINE'S HOME FOR PECULIAR CHILDREN, and the Starz TV series Sweetbitter (pictured above), has signed on to star in DAWN OF THE DEAD remake director Zack Snyder's new zombie film ARMY OF THE DEAD.

Dave Bautista is playing a "dry-witted, thoughtful" man named Scott in the film, and Purnell will be playing his daughter Kate, a "taciturn, hard-working, driven" volunteer with the World Health Organization.

Written by Snyder and Shay Hatten, ARMY OF THE DEAD is an adventure film that is 

set amid a zombie outbreak in Las Vegas, during which a man assembles a group of mercenaries to take the ultimate gamble: venturing into the quarantined zone to pull off the greatest heist ever attempted. 

Along with the announcement of Purnell's casting comes the news that three more actors have joined the cast. They are Ana De La Reguera, who has been in NACHO LIBRE, COP OUT, and the From Dusk Till Dawn TV show; Theo Rossi of Luke Cage, Sons of Anarchy, and CLOVERFIELD; and Huma Qureshi of the Bollywood remake of OCULUS, which was called DOBAARA: SEE YOUR EVIL. The names of the characters they will be playing were not revealed.

ARMY OF THE DEAD is a Netflix project that Snyder is producing with Deborah Snyder and Wesley Coller. Ori Marmur and Andrew Norman are overseeing the production for Netflix.

Filming is expected to begin in July.
